Meaning and Origin

Clayre, a name with Latin roots, is a variant of Claire, meaning "bright" or "famous." This meaning, reflecting radiance and recognition, suggests a personality full of light and a destiny destined for success. Though Claire is a well-established name, Clayre holds a unique appeal, offering a touch of individuality without sacrificing the essence of its meaning.

Religion and Cultural Associations

Clayre, through its connection to Claire, holds religious associations with Christianity, where it is often associated with St. Clare of Assisi. This association reinforces the name's connection to faith, light, and devotion. Variation and Similar Names

The name Clayre offers a few variations, such as "Claira" or "Clayrea," but these variations are not as common. Names like "Claire," "Clare," "Clara," and "Clarissa" offer similar sounds and share the same meaning, representing variations in spelling and style.
